Building raising services involve elevating existing structures to a higher level, typically to protect against flooding, improve foundation stability, or meet updated building codes. The process usually includes lifting the entire building using specialized equipment, such as hydraulic jacks, and then adding a new foundation or supports underneath. Once the building is raised, the structure is carefully lowered onto the new foundation, ensuring structural integrity and stability are maintained throughout the process. This service is often tailored to the specific needs of each property, considering factors like building size, foundation type, and site conditions.

The overview below groups typical Building Raising proj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in White Lake,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Preparation - The cost for site assessment and foundation prep typically ranges from $2,000 to $6,000, depending on soil conditions and site size. For example, a residential property in White Lake, MI might fall within this range based on its specific needs.
Raising Equipment and Materials - Expenses for jacks, beams, and other materials usually vary between $1,500 and $4,000. Larger or more complex projects may require additional resources, increasing overall costs.
Labor Costs - Labor charges for building raising services generally range from $3,000 to $8,000, influenced by project scope and accessibility. Local contractors in White Lake, MI may charge within this spectrum based on the project's complexity.
Permits and Additional Fees - Permit costs and related fees often add $500 to $2,000 to the total expense. These costs depend on local regulations and specific project requirements in the area.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
